SMART on FHIR
SMART App Launch v2.2 — what most implementations get wrong about the token response

patient, encounter, and need_patient_banner must be top-level JSON fields in the token response body — not buried inside the JWT payload. Here is why it matters and how to fix it.

Patient Identity
Building a Master Patient Index for a hospital chain — probabilistic matching at 50M records

How JamMPI resolves patient identity across branches using Jaro-Winkler name scoring, national ID exact match, and blocking strategies that keep comparison time sub-100ms at 50M records.
